History

In 2001 the Conservation District celebrated fifty years of service to the communities of Houghton and Keweenaw counties. Begun in 1951, the Houghton Keweenaw Conservation District has a rich history of working with area farmers and landowners.

The district has begun to research this history and is currently developing a library of salvaged archives including old newspaper articles, photos, and documentation.
